The WP Support Plus Responsive Ticket System pl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Authentication Bypass in versions up to, and including, 7.1.4. This is due to the plugin only requiring a valid email for the loginGuestFacebook AJAX action which is passed to the wp_set_auth_cookie() function and will log the user in as the account associated with the supplied email.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to log in as any users account, including administrators.
